SB 2131 ND Introduced
A BILL for an Act to provide an appropriation to the attorney general for the crime laboratory.

Action history (10)
- Jan 3, 2023 Introduced, first reading, referred State and Local Government Committee · upper
- Jan 12, 2023 Committee Hearing 11:00 · upper
- Jan 12, 2023 Committee Hearing 02:30 · upper
- Feb 3, 2023 Committee Hearing 10:05 · upper
- Feb 3, 2023 Reported back amended, do pass, amendment placed on calendar 6 0 0 · upper
- Feb 6, 2023 Amendment adopted · upper
- Feb 6, 2023 Rereferred to Appropriations · upper
- Feb 13, 2023 Committee Hearing 02:30 · upper
- Feb 14, 2023 Reported back, do not pass, placed on calendar 16 0 0 · upper
- Feb 15, 2023 Second reading, failed to pass, yeas 2 nays 44 · upper
